2025/03 17

6. 관계

Q1집합 A={1,2,3,4}, B={3.4}일 때, R={(a,b)|a+b=5}로 옳은 것은?13 R3이 성립한다.24 R4이 성립한다.32 R3이 성립하지 않는다.41 R4이 성립한다.정답입니다.정답 : 4  3. 추이적이지 않다. 루프가 다있기때문에 반사적임이 그래프는 반사적이다. 2->3이 있다면 ,   3->2가 없기때문에 반사적이지 않은 것이다. 3->1 1->2 가 있다면 3->2 가 있어야되는데 없어서 추이적이지않음 ✅ 자기 자신으로만 이루어진 관계(자기반사적 원소)들은 자동으로 추이적입니다.즉,(1,1)∈R(1,1) \in R(1,1)∈R이고 (1,1)∈R(1,1) \in R(1,1)∈R이므로 (1,1)∈R(1,1) \in R(1,1)∈R → 문제 없음(2,2)∈R(2,2) \in R(2..

수업/이산수학 2025.03.12

5.행렬

1) 0행이 0행이 아닌행보다 위에 있어서 행제형행렬이 아님2) 모든 선도원소는 1이어야한다. 아님3) 선도원소는 왼쪽상단부터 오른쪽 하단순서로 나와야함4) 행제형행렬이 맞다 1)행제형행렬이 아님2) 선도원소의 열에서 선도원소를 제외한 원소는 0이어야한다. 소거행제형이 아님3) 선도원소의 열에서 선도원소를 제외한 원소는 0이어야한다.  소거행제형이 아님4)소거행제형 맞다  정방행렬 : n x n 행렬을 n차 정방행렬이라고 함대각행렬 : n차 정방행렬에서 대각원소 이외의 모든 원소가 0인 행렬을 대각행렬이라고 한다. ( 영행렬도 대각행렬이다)단위행렬 : 스칼라행렬중에 k=1인것대칭행렬:  n차 정방행렬에서 aij =aji1) 다 아님2) 정방행렬, 대칭행렬3) 정방행렬, 대각행렬, 대칭행렬4) 정방,대각,..

수업/이산수학 2025.03.11

4. 집합론

답 : 1번, 3번   답 - 2, 3, 4원소이냐와 부분집합이냐라는 기호를 잘 구분할것  왼쪽 1,2,3은 분할이 아님공집합은 분할에 포함되면안됨 { {1,2,3} } 이건 분할맞음   {a,b,c} 는 AAA의 부분집합이므로 멱집합에 포함됨.하지만 {{a,b,c}}\{ \{ a, b, c \} \}{{a,b,c}} 는 부분집합이 아니라 하나의 원소를 포함하는 집합이므로 멱집합의 원소가 아니다.즉, 멱집합은 AAA의 부분집합을 원소로 가지지만, 부분집합을 감싼 형태(집합 안에 집합을 넣은 형태)는 포함되지 않는다.

수업/이산수학 2025.03.11

3.증명

공리: 다른 명제를 증명하기위해 전제로 사용되는 가장 기본적인 가정으로 별도의 증명없이 참으로 이용되는 명제 정리: 공리로부터 증명된 명제 보조정리 : 정리를 증명하기위한 과정 중에 사용되는 증명된 명제 따름정리 : 정리로부터 쉽게 도출되는 부가적인 명제증명방법 ㄴ직접 증명법 : 공리와 정의 그리고 정리를 논리적으로 직접 연결하여 증명 ㄴ수학적 귀납법 자연수 n에 대한 명제의 성질을 증명하는데 유용한 증명방법. 기본단계, 귀납가정, 귀납단계를 이용한다. ㄴ간접증명법 : 증명해야할 명제를 증명하기 쉬운 형태로 변형하여 증명하는 방법이다. ㄴㄴ대우증명법,모순증명법, 반례증명법 존재증명법 직접증명법 : (연역법) 이미 증명된 하나 또는 둘 이상의 명제를 전제로하여 새로운 명제를 결론으로 이끌어 내는것

수업/이산수학 2025.03.10

3.자바문법

protected 키워드를 사용하면 다음과 같은 범위에서 접근할 수 있습니다:✅ 같은 패키지 내에서는 자유롭게 접근 가능✅ 다른 패키지라도 상속받은 클래스에서는 접근 가능❌ 다른 패키지에서 직접 접근할 수 없음 (단, 상속받은 경우 가능)2. protected와 다른 접근 제어자 비교접근 제어자                                                        같은 클래스 // 같은 패키지 // 다른 패키지 (상속 X)  //  다른 패키지 (상속 O)publicOOOOprotectedOOXOdefaultOOXXprivateOXXX     Q1다음 중 문법적으로 올바른 문장은 무엇인가?1int a[10] = new int[ ];2int b[ ] = new int(10);3..

수업/자바 2025.03.09

1.자바와 객체 지향 프로그래밍 2.자바 기본 문법

Java 언어의 특징을 나열할 수 있다.운영체제와 무관, 하드웨어 플랫폼에 독립적객체지향 프로그래밍언어데스크톱응용외에 웹 또는 네트워크 프로그래밍이 용이변수 등의 사용에 있어서 엄격한 자료형의 검사예외 처리 기능 제공멀티 스레딩 지원바이트 코드, Java 플랫폼에 관해 설명할 수 있다.자바플랫폼을 설치(실행환경) 플랫폼에서 동작하는 코드로 컴파일.  운영체제가 실행환경이 되는게 아님Java VM : 자바프로그램의 실행환경을 제공. 자바프로그램의 구동엔진, 메모리 정리 자동수행(garbage collection)Java API : 프로그램개발에 필요한 클래스 라이브러리자바소스파일(.java) ->컴파일러 -> 자바 바이트코드(.class)  -> Java VM -> 실행Java 프로그래밍을 위한 개발 환경..

수업/자바 2025.03.05